Job description / Role

Employment: Full Time

Uses and promotes the use of the sales process to aide in cultivating and managing long term relationships and in seeking out new sales opportunities.
Must have experience withHVAC/Controls industry
Represents product and technology offerings during the sales process to the end customer.
Analyzes channel performance and established new channels in the market.
Works with the indirect channel accounts to deploy new product offerings and upgrades and ensures they are informed and trained on the products, features, value proposition, and pricing and that they are trained properly to install and service the products properly to keep projects on time and within budget. Ensures compliance with state, local and Federal legal requirements and operates the with the highest business ethics.
Acts as the local expert for products and technology sold to the Components Sales Channel.
Sells, renews and expands product agreements to both key and targeted customers to reach optimal sales and profit levels.
Responsible for meeting assigned product sales goals and objectives.
Recommends product solutions and links to customer objectives to total value solution and competitive advantage.
Directly manages and recruits Manufacturers Representatives to sell products and support distribution customer accounts.
Makes decisions on market and account coverage by Manufacturers Representatives and adds / terminates agreements based on sales volume achieved.
Creates partnering opportunities with the principles responsible for the decision making process.
Actively listens, probes and identifies concerns. Understands customer's business and speaks their language.
Manages ongoing sales process and responds to and anticipates customer needs.

Requirements

REQUIREMENTS:
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Business, or equivalent sales and technical experience. Minimum of eight year’s progressive, direct sales experience, preferably in the HVAC/Controls industry. Able to relate to people at all levels, communicating both on a technical and non-technical basis. MBA is preferred. Demonstrated exceptional interpersonal, verbal and written communication skills. Possesses excellent presentation skills and proficiency at making one on one and group presentations. Able to travel a minimum of 50%.
